## Understanding Your Needs

Before diving into the available options, it’s essential to understand your specific needs. Think about how you intend to use your garage space. For instance, if you operate a warehouse where large vehicles frequently come and go, you may need wide access. On the other hand, if your business is a small auto shop that mainly deals with cars, you might opt for a smaller, more traditional garage gate.

Also, consider the security level required for your business. High-security environments, such as distribution centers or auto-repair shops, must have robust and reliable gates to prevent unauthorized access. In contrast, a boutique store that only uses its garage for receiving supplies may not require the same level of security.

## Types of Commercial Garage Gates

Understanding the different types of commercial garage gates available is crucial. Common options include:

1. **Roll-Up Doors**: Ideal for businesses with limited space, these doors roll into a coil above the entrance when opened, maximizing usable floor space. For a restaurant that needs frequent supplies delivered, a roll-up door allows easy access without sacrificing space.

2. **Sectional Doors**: These doors are composed of several panels that slide upwards when opened. They suit businesses where insulation is vital, such as auto repair shops, as they keep the interior temperature consistent.

3. **Bi-Folding Doors**: Perfect for industries like logistics or manufacturing, bifolding doors open quickly and offer wide entry, allowing large vehicles to pass through without delay.

4. **High-Speed Doors**: Commonly used in settings that require frequent opening and closing, such as food and beverage manufacturing, high-speed doors can be a game-changer for efficiency.

Understanding these options allows you to choose commercial garage gates that fit your business model while enhancing efficiency and security.

## Factors to Consider

### 1. Material

The material you choose for your commercial garage gate can significantly influence its longevity and functionality. Common materials include steel, aluminum, and fiberglass.

– **Steel**: Known for its durability and resistance to wear and tear, steel gates are perfect for high-traffic businesses. For example, a freight warehouse can utilize steel gates to withstand daily usage and potential collisions from forklifts.

– **Aluminum**: Lightweight and resistant to corrosion, aluminum is ideal for businesses located in coastal areas where saltwater exposure can accelerate deterioration. A car dealership in such a location may benefit from aluminum gates for long-lasting performance.

### 2. Security Features

Given that security is one of the primary functions of commercial garage gates, it is worth investing in gates that offer advanced security features. Consider options like:

– **Automated access control**: This feature allows you to control who enters your premises through electronic keypads, remote controls, or even smartphone apps. A self-storage facility, for example, can improve customer experience by allowing clients to access their units without waiting for staff assistance.

– **Reinforced frames**: Gates with reinforced structures can deter unauthorized entry and withstand potential impacts. A facility storing valuable equipment, such as a construction company’s yard, might choose gates with these features for added peace of mind.

### 3. Design and Aesthetics

The design of your commercial garage gates can influence the perceived image of your business. A well-designed gate adds character and professionalism to your premises. For instance, an upscale auto dealership may prefer elegant, sleek sectional doors made of high-quality materials to enhance its brand image. In contrast, a manufacturing facility might prioritize functionality over aesthetics with more utilitarian designs.

## Maintenance and Longevity

Choosing the right commercial garage gates is only part of the equation; maintaining them is equally important. Regular inspection and upkeep can prevent costly repairs down the line. Simple measures, such as lubricating moving parts and cleaning tracks, can significantly extend the lifespan of your gates. For instance, a vehicle repair shop that undergoes daily tire-changing sessions can benefit from routine inspections to ensure gates operate smoothly and efficiently.

Investing in high-quality commercial garage gates typically leads to lower long-term costs, especially when you factor in maintenance needs. An initial investment in durable, well-manufactured gates will pay off in less frequent repairs and replacements.
